Who are Novus?

Novus are a leading provider of prison education and have been supporting men, women, and children of all ages for over 30 years across the UK to take new directions. We are also part of the LTE group of亿 companies that include The Manchester College, MOL, Total People, UCEN, and LTE Group Operations. We are currently rated “Good” by Ofsted and have partnerships with over 1000 industry and employer partners, ensuring our learners secure their place as the movers and shakers of the future. Site Information

HMP Five Wells is a Category C prison that is based in Wellingborough. Built in 2022, and costing £253m, this state‑of‑the‑art prison accommodates a male prison population. HMP Five Wells are committed to celebrating diversity and promoting equality throughout their services. The prison’s aim is to make Five Wells a better place to live, work and visit through collaborative working with third‑party partners, the MOJ and its surrounding communities.
